Transaction 2c2d12f4b40bbce59e7d6556f95ecacc00ccc697188d3224fdbb0ab2f1598568

27 Input
2 Outputs
  • 2c2d12f4b40bbce59e7d6556f95ecacc00ccc697188d3224fdbb0ab2f1598568:0
  • value  139640247
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 2c2d12f4b40bbce59e7d6556f95ecacc00ccc697188d3224fdbb0ab2f1598568:1
  • value  592698
    address  1Q1Ec5okJ9jZkkeUetqzWV5LJFK5HXGSy7